你查询的IP:[203.86.100.106]  地理位置:印度

最新查询116.95.61.141 114.60.81.15 221.136.150.235 60.209.249.212 119.164.10.207 116.52.113.173 118.64.177.145 120.52.180.112 116.242.63.247 203.86.100.106 210.12.47.87 59.64.132.219 119.4.37.131 202.149.224.114 116.89.144.254 122.51.73.249 203.196.137.123 120.92.75.87 219.82.92.88 116.213.128.157 123.199.128.131 118.180.136.33 124.20.22.194 118.67.112.19 210.25.67.209 122.248.48.236 192.83.169.12 202.173.8.214 202.90.129.117 121.52.208.113 203.158.16.146